That's right. Texas is considered part of the Southwestern culture, along with New Mexico and Arizona.
Texas did join the Confederacy, however, and boasts about being the last Confederate state to hold out during the Civil War.
The last battle of the Civil War, the Battle of Palmito Ranch, was fought in Texas on May 12, 1865, well after Robert E. Lee's surrender on April 9, 1865, at the Appomattox Court House, Virginia.
Ironically, Palmito Ranch was a Confederate victory. - Reply to this comment
